Transaction 11502b1383d279eeea0792a927c0cdae357af497b76d1ba2caacb419a55e0397
1 Input
1 Output
-
11502b1383d279eeea0792a927c0cdae357af497b76d1ba2caacb419a55e0397:0
- value
- 21950000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02ca1f3d07c71167871bf62f24478468ddb9e2bb OP_EQUAL
- address
- M89uiVrhN41447HFrjEbP1eTVKGGf1YoD8